Factors Affecting Cost
- Material: The type of material used, such as concrete, stone, or brick, can significantly impact the cost.
- Labor: Labor costs can vary based on the complexity of the installation and the experience of the workers.
- Permits: Some installations may require permits, which can add to the overall expense.
- Site Preparation: The condition of the site, including the need for excavation or grading, can affect the cost.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s or custom features can increase both material and labor costs.
- Location: Proximity to suppliers and the availability of materials in Midland, TX, can influence the price.
Average Costs for
Task | Price Range |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Curb | $10 - $15 per linear foot |
Stone Walkway Curb | $20 - $30 per linear foot |
Brick Walkway Curb | $15 - $25 per linear foot |
Site Preparation | $500 - $1,500 total |
Permit Fees | $100 - $300 total |
Labor Costs | $50 - $75 per hour |
